New Soulcalibur VI Antagonist Azwel Revealed

Soulcalibur VI

We might be a little slow on the uptake with this one as it was announced over the bank holiday weekend, but Bandai Namco have officially revealed the new character Azwel for Soulcalibur VI, who you might remember as the big evil bad lad from the Libra of Soul trailer that debuted at Gamescom.

In his new gameplay trailer, which you can check out below, Azwel bares some similarities to another Soulcalibur bad guy, Algol, who could also manifest weapons from his hands to carve up his competition. Azwel appears to take this one step further, being able to summon hundreds of swords during his Critical Edge like he’s Noctis on steroids. He also has a fantastic looking backbreaker command grab where he plucks opponents from the air, so naturally I want to play as him right now.

Interestingly, the trailer concludes with a look at a demonic version of Azwel, which could either be a version of the character who uses a Soul Charge, similar to how Kilik becomes a big demon lad during his Soul Charge, or an unplayable final boss version that’ll appear during the climax of the Libra of Soul mode.

Soulcalibur VI will be out on October 19th for PS4, Xbox One and PC. Are you excited? Let us know in the comments.
